Champlain College Online -Subject Matter Experts (remote)



Job Description:

The Champlain College Online division is seeking Subject Matter Experts (SMEs). SMEs develop relevant and engaging content for CCO's adult students who are seeking to better themselves through education. We have immediate openings for candidates to develop and teach courses in:
  • Data Science
  • Software Engineering (UML experience required)
  • Software Development Project Management (professional experience required)
  • Programming - Python, Java
  • Database Administration and Development

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op a vision for the course in conjunction with the program director responsible for oversight of the course and its role in CCO programs
  • Complete a Course Design Document (CDD)
  • Develop course content, including but not limited to:
  • Module Overviews
  • Module Learning Outcomes
  • Lectures (written, audio, video, interactive)
  • Assessments (discussions, quizzes/tests, labs, written assignments, projects, etc.)
  • Rubrics
  • Teaching aids, e.g. answer keys, that instructors may use to assess achievement of learning outcomes
  • Select required and supplemental resources (texts, articles, audio and video recordings, etc.)
  • Work with an instructional designer and other CCO staff, such as members of CCO's eLearning team and the operations manager, to bring the course development project to completion according to an agreed upon timeline



Requirements:

  • A master's degree, doctorate, or PhD demonstrating advanced understanding of the topic(s) that will be covered in the course design/development
  • Professional experience - current/past employment, certifications, trainings, published materials, and presentations - demonstrating practical application of concepts, and knowledge of current methods, technologies, and trends in the field(s) related to the course topic(s)
  • Experience with developing courses for and/or instruction of adult learners*

*If a SME does not have experience with adult learners, it is recommended the applicant successfully complete Champlain College Online's (CCO) introductory course for teaching online.
